Within the framework of nutritional ecology, subsistence diversification is achieved by adding different species to a diet, but explanations for this diversification vary. In the Broad Spectrum Revolution approach, explanations include demographic, ecological, nutritional and technological factors, as well as the mobility of hunter-gatherer groups. The origin of small animal assemblages is a key issue underlying this debate, as these were an important food resource for several non-human predators (diurnal and nocturnal birds of prey and terrestrial carnivores). To establish the genesis of these accumulations, it is important to analyse the anatomical and age profiles of the animals, the bone breakage patterns and the bone surface modifications. With this aim, we present data from the Level IV faunal assemblage of Bolomor Cave (Valencia, Spain). Level IV, corresponding to MIS 5e, shows human use not only of small animals but also of large- and small-sized carnivores in addition to ungulates. Anthropogenic evidence includes cut-marks, intentional bone breakage, burning patterns and human tooth-marks. The utilisation of other less frequent animals could be related to a generalist human behaviour based on the exploitation of a broad range of prey, and could also be associated with an early diversification of the human diet in this locality. This study aims to provide data concerning human consumption of small prey, to establish the processing sequence both of large/medium and small animals and to contribute to the knowledge of human subsistence strategies in the European Middle Palaeolithic. 相似文献

A Nested Polymerase Chain Reaction Protocol for in planta Detection of Fusicladium eriobotryae,Causal Agent of Loquat Scab 下载免费PDF全文
Elisa González‐Domínguez Maela León Josep Armengol Mónica Berbegal 《Journal of Phytopathology》2015,163(5):415-418
Scab caused by the fungus Fusicladium eriobotryae is the most serious disease affecting loquat in Spain. Isolation of F. eriobotryae from infected tissue on culture media can be difficult due to its slow growth. A polymerase chain reaction (PCR)‐based protocol was developed for F. eriobotryae‐specific identification from pure culture or infected loquat tissues. The primer set was designed in the elongation factor 1‐α gene (EF1‐α), and specificity and sensitivity for single and nested PCR were validated. The nested PCR assay resulted in 100% positive detection of F. eriobotryae in naturally and artificially infected tissues. This protocol can be useful for routine diagnosis, disease monitoring programmes and epidemiological research. 相似文献

RNA viruses are known to replicate at very high mutation rates. These rates are actually known to be close to their so-called error threshold. This threshold is in fact a critical point beyond which genetic information is lost through a so-called error catastrophe. However, the transition from a stable quasispecies to genetic drift and loss of information can also occur by crossing replication thresholds, below some replication rates, the viral population is suddenly unable to survive. Available data from hepatitis C virus population analysis [Mas, A., Ulloa, E., Bruguera, M., Furci?, I., Garriga, D., Fábregas, S., Andreu, D., Saiz, J.C., Díez, J., 2004. Hepatitis C virus population analysis of a single-source nosocomial outbreak reveals an inverse correlation between viral load and quasispecies complexity. J. Gen. Virol. 85, 3619-3626] can be interpreted through this theoretical view, providing evidence for such a replication threshold. Here a simple model is used in order to provide evidence for such a phenomenon, consistent with available data. 相似文献

C 2 domains are well characterized as Ca 2+/phospholipid-binding modules, but little is known about how they mediate protein–protein interactions. In neurons, a Munc13–1 C 2A-domain/RIM zinc-finger domain (ZF) heterodimer couples synaptic vesicle priming to presynaptic plasticity. We now show that the Munc13–1 C 2A domain homodimerizes, and that homodimerization competes with Munc13–1/RIM heterodimerization. X-ray diffraction studies guided by nuclear magnetic resonance (NMR) experiments reveal the crystal structures of the Munc13–1 C 2A-domain homodimer and the Munc13–1 C 2A-domain/RIM ZF heterodimer at 1.44 Å and 1.78 Å resolution, respectively. The C 2A domain adopts a β-sandwich structure with a four-stranded concave side that mediates homodimerization, leading to the formation of an eight-stranded β-barrel. In contrast, heterodimerization involves the bottom tip of the C 2A-domain β-sandwich and a C-terminal α-helical extension, which wrap around the RIM ZF domain. Our results describe the structural basis for a Munc13–1 homodimer–Munc13–1/RIM heterodimer switch that may be crucial for vesicle priming and presynaptic plasticity, uncovering at the same time an unexpected versatility of C 2 domains as protein–protein interaction modules, and illustrating the power of combining NMR spectroscopy and X-ray crystallography to study protein complexes. 相似文献

Linezolid is an effective antimicrobial agent to treat methicillin-resistant Staphylococcus aureus (MRSA). Resistance to linezolid due to the cfr gene is described worldwide. The present study aimed to analyze the prevalence of the cfr–mediated linezolid resistance among MRSA clinical isolates in our area. A very low prevalence of cfr mediated linezolid resistance was found: only one bacteremic isolate out of 2 215 screened isolates. The only linezolid resistant isolate arose in a patient, previously colonized by MRSA, following linezolid therapy. Despite the low rate of resistance in our area, ongoing surveillance is advisable to avoid the spread of linezolid resistance. 相似文献

The function of Cyclin D1 (CycD1) has been widely studied in the cell nucleus as a regulatory subunit of the cyclin-dependent kinases Cdk4/6 involved in the control of proliferation and development in mammals. CycD1 has been also localized in the cytoplasm, where its function nevertheless is poorly characterized. In this work we have observed that in normal skin as well as in primary cultures of human keratinocytes, cytoplasmic localization of CycD1 correlated with the degree of differentiation of the keratinocyte. In these conditions, CycD1 co-localized in cytoplasmic foci with exocyst components (Sec6) and regulators (RalA), and with β1 integrin, suggesting a role for CycD1 in the regulation of keratinocyte adhesion during differentiation. Consistent with this hypothesis, CycD1 overexpression increased β1 integrin recycling and drastically reduced the ability of keratinocytes to adhere to the extracellular matrix. We propose that localization of CycD1 in the cytoplasm during skin differentiation could be related to the changes in detachment ability of keratinocytes committed to differentiation. 相似文献

The aquarium trade has been identified as an important vector of aquatic invasive species but this question has mostly been investigated in North America. We investigated the variation in diversity and species composition in different trade types in southwestern Europe (three major international wholesalers, different retail store types, and local internet forums), mostly in Spain and Portugal. As in previous studies, the diversity of fishes in the aquarium trade was vast, with a total of 20 orders, 79 families, and 1,133 fish species detected in the trade types analyzed. 248 species were observed in a single metropolitan area (Barcelona), with estimates of about 294 species being present. International wholesalers had higher species richness and evenness, with a single one having over 700 species. General pet stores had much lower evenness but due to high turnover had a total richness of over 200 species. Internet forums had the lowest evenness but similar richness. The different commerce types varied significantly in relative species abundance with about a dozen of popular fish species (e.g., goldfish, Siamese fighting fish, common carp, guppy, swordtails) dominating the retail stores, particularly the general pet stores. Our results imply that frequency in the trade varies strongly among species and commerce types and although general pet stores have usually low diversity, this is compensated with a higher species turnover. Many of the most popular species are well known invasive species and some of the species available are temperate species that might establish in Europe, reinforcing the need for more careful implementation of education programs, regulation and monitoring of trade, and internalization of environmental costs by the industry. 相似文献
